Output 614e956d8a413a38ed53f6dc941086975a51b121a74655bb070529123318df17:0

value
1060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50bffc609c9e7f88ae3d372add28fde6b5adbae7 OP_EQUAL
address
393yyJQHv35aD6oRNMtDW7rWYsARY8CkT1
transaction
614e956d8a413a38ed53f6dc941086975a51b121a74655bb070529123318df17
spent
true